United Cerebral Palsy of Georgia is seeking a Night Shift Train Cleaner for the Heaton Depot in Newcastle upon Tyne. This position involves essential duties to prepare trains for daily service, including vacuuming, sanitising, and deep cleaning.

The role offers a pay of £13.57 per hour with opportunities for overtime and career progression. A strong work ethic and attention to detail are essential, and full training and PPE will be provided. Join a leading rail operator and support clean travel across the North of England.
